As most of us have already suspected narcissistic personality disorder does have some of its roots in childhood experiences, particularly those involving trauma or neglect. While the exact causes of NPD are not fully understood, research suggests that adverse childhood experiences may contribute to the development of narcissistic traits. Some individuals with NPD may have experienced significant childhood trauma, such as physical or emotional abuse, neglect, or inconsistent parenting. These early experiences can shape their worldview and self-perception, leading to the development of narcissistic defenses as a means of self-protection and coping.
It is not uncommon for individuals with NPD to also have comorbid conditions such as depression, anxiety disorders, substance abuse, or borderline personality disorder. The presence of these additional conditions can complicate the diagnosis and treatment of NPD, and it highlights the importance of a comprehensive and holistic approach to addressing an individual's mental health.
